Press "Enter" to skip to content

‘Did We Win?': We Have a Miraculous Update on the Status of Buffalo Bills’ Hamlin

After days of waiting for positive updates on the condition of Buffalo Bills’ injured player Damar Hamlin, news broke Thursday that brought fans tears of joy. Continue reading…
Source: WIBX 950

Be First to Comment

    Leave a Reply